Defaqto announces improved suitability
letters in Aequos Engage
Defaqto is pleased to announce that it has enhanced the suitability letters capability within Aequos Engage by incorporating ATEB Suitability www.atebsuitability.co.uk,
following a successful pilot scheme that was carried out towards the end of 2007 ATEB Suitability is a bespoke version of Intelledox, the smart document creation software

Intelledox is partnered with ATEB Business Solutions, a specialist compliance consultancy with extensive industry experience that distributes Intelledox as part of its systematic approach to compliance, based on good business practice and risk management strategies.
ATEB's suitability report templates have proved extremely robust in compliance terms and used in conjunction with Intelledox, they virtually eliminate the possibility of error.
Commenting on the incorporation of ATEB Suitability into Defaqto Engage, ATEB Director Huw Reynold's said: "The industry has been crying out for this type of software for years.

Existing report generators are all well and good, but there is too much reliance on user input and hence error rates are high.
Intelledox virtually eliminates errors by forcing the user through a simple 'wizard' type interface.
Letters are produced more quickly and the work can be delegated.
The result is a quality end product every time.
As suitability reports are an essential risk management tool, this software provides a significant advance."
